Step-by-step explanation:
The problem can also be solved by using sine rule:
sin47/EG = sin48/FG = sin85/EF
So EG is the shortest in triangle EFG
In triangle DEG, sin52/DG = sin67/EG = sin61/DE
So DG is the shortest side and it is equal to:
DG = EG*sin52/sin67
Because sin52/sin67 < 1, DG < EG
DG is the shortest side.
